Half a thousand professionals from all over the Iberian Peninsula will gather at the III Spanish-Portuguese Extensive Livestock Congress which, under the motto ‘Guaranteed Sustainability’, will be held at the Cáceres Congress Palace, on December 1 and 2 2022. This international Congress is organized by Agri-Food Cooperatives of Spain, with the participation of the territorial unions of Andalusia, Castilla y León and Extremadura, the Andalusian Federation of Animal Health Defense Groups, ACOS-Associaçâo de Agricultores do Sul and the Uniâo two Alentejo Health Defense Groups, with the support of various sponsoring and collaborating entities.
The III Spanish-Portuguese Congress of Extensive Livestock Farming, for which registration is now open, “is proposed with the aim of addressing the technical-scientific and agricultural policy aspects associated with extensive livestock farming and highlighting its environmental and territorial benefits. , economic and social”, as highlighted by the president of Cooperativas Agro-alimentarias Extremadura, Ángel Pacheco, during the presentation of this international congress.
For his part, the president of Acos, Rui Garrido, explained that the III Spanish-Portuguese Extensive Livestock Congress will be a meeting point for hundreds of Spanish and Portuguese professionals to, over two days, “exchange experiences in order to improve the knowledge of both producers and technicians to optimize resources in production and sanitation.
In addition, during the congress the marketing of products, the market situation and consumer trends will be analyzed, in addition to health challenges, the integration of the production sector and the application of new technologies will be other issues discussed, as and as Agustín González, from the Andalusian Federation of Animal Health Defense Groups, highlighted.
This meeting will feature the experience of experts from Spain and Portugal, both livestock farmers, cooperatives and non-cooperative companies, researchers, distribution representatives and representatives of the European Union, the Spanish and Portuguese national administration and the regional governments of the areas of influence.
Thus, the III Hispano-Portuguese Extensive Livestock Congress will be inaugurated by the president of the Government of Extremadura, Guillermo Fernández Vara; the Minister of Agriculture, Fisheries and Food of Spain, Luis Planas Puchades, and the Minister of Agriculture of Portugal, Maria do Céu Antunes, both pending confirmation; and representatives of the event organization.
Technical-scientific program
The technical-scientific program of the III Spanish-Portuguese Extensive Livestock Congress will open on December 1 with an inaugural presentation on “European Strategies for extensive livestock farming”, by the European Commission, which will give way to the first round table which will address extensive animal production, in which aspects such as digitalization and technological advances in extensive livestock farming and sustainable management models in La Dehesa/Montado will be analyzed. Subsequently, a round table will be held on animal and plant health, with the official opening scheduled for 1:00 p.m.
The afternoon session of this first day will continue with a round table that will discuss the ecosystem as a generator of value based on aspects such as fighting livestock, rural tourism, hunting and conservation resources and the application in avant-garde cuisine. After this, a round table will take place on the promotion and marketing of products from the pasture.
The program will continue on December 2, starting at 9:30 a.m., with presentations and round tables on social, economic and environmental sustainability and Community Agrarian Policy in extensive livestock farming.
